Description of problem: 
The last F20 ppc64 arch build of Perl is 5.18.2-289 by dwa on 2014-01-07. 
The last F21 ppc64 arch build is 5.18.4-305 by sharkcz on 2014-10-21.

Primary arch F20 Perl is 5.18.4 (-289 by jplesnik on 2014/10/03, -291 by ppisar
on 2014/10/30, and -292 by by jplesnik on 2015/02/13).

Recent F20 noarch package builds have requires for Perl(:MODULE_COMPAT_5.18.4:
- 4:perl-Pos-Usage-1.64-2.fc20.noarch 
- perl-DateTime-Timezone-1.76-1.fc20.noarch  
Last F21 ppc64 

These are required for network installation to begin, so essentially prevent
all new F20 ppc64 network installs since Anaconda doesn't seem to be respecting
the "don't use updates" flag.

Please do a perl 5.18.4-305 build for ppc64 to eliminate these and future
problems.

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): Current 5.18.2 
Need 5.18.4 to match primary arch.

How reproducible:
100%

Steps to Reproduce:
1. Boot F20 netinst CD
2. Select any desktop (Gnome, Mate, XFCE)
3. Note broken dependency message 

Actual results:
Install begin button is inactive.  Can not begin install.

Expected results:
Active install begin button, allowing successful install.


Additional info:
See above.  Perl on primary arch promoted to 5.18-4, so any updates to noarch
perl packages after Feb 13th are likely to fail the same way.
